Description: Chime is a video conferencing and collaboration platform developed by Amazon Web Services (AWS). Designed for virtual meetings, Chime offers features such as high-definition video, clear audio, screen sharing, and messaging. It is suitable for remote work, online meetings, and team collaboration.

Description: Adium is a free and open source instant messaging application for macOS that supports multiple protocols including AIM, ICQ, Jabber/XMPP, MSN, Yahoo and more. It allows you to chat across different networks in one application with a simple and customizable interface.
